5 Signs You're A Delta Zeta

If you are, consider yourself blessed.

186
5 Signs You're A Delta Zeta

Greek Life is a wonderful thing. Joining a sorority is one of the best decisions I have ever made, because in any sorority you can find lifelong friends and sisters as well as involvement and leadership. Having said that, Delta Zeta stands out to me in such a big way, and I'm grateful to be part of such a wonderful group of women. Here are five things that you already know to be true if you are lucky enough to be a Delta Zeta.

1. The colors pink and green are close to your heart

As a sister of Delta Zeta, you probably wear these two colors all the time. There is also a good chance that your notebooks, backpacks, tumblers, phone case, and dorm decorations are also in these colors (and most likely in our Lilly print) because we're sorority girls and that's how we do things.

2. You're obsessed with turtles

Every sorority has its mascot, and ours is the turtle. That fact combined with the fact that we're, well, girls should explain enough. Besides, who doesn't love an adorable baby turtle?

3. You have a soft spot for the support of speech and hearing

Because of our partnership with, and support of, the Starkey Hearing Foundation and the Painted Turtle Camp, we DZ's naturally want to do all that we can to help the hearing impaired live normal lives. It's a cause that we hold near and dear to us.

4. October 24th is one of the most important days of the year for you

On the anniversary of the day that six lovely ladies- Alfa Lloyd, Anna Keen, Anne Simmons, Julia Bishop, Mary Collins, and Mabelle Minton- founded our sorority, we gather together for our Founder's Day ceremony and celebrate the wonderful group of women who made us and acknowledge that without them we wouldn't be who we are today.

5. You would do anything for your sisters

Of course this is true for any sorority, but Delta Zetas always stick together. Loyal friends and sisters are what each and every one of us needs, so we try to be that for one another. A true Delta Zeta always looks out for her sisters.
